The arrival time in london of a train that leaves Leicester to london at 11:50 A.M is 13:05 pm.
To calculate the arrival time in london of a train that leaves Leicester to london at 11:50 A.M, use use the formula below.
Formula:
- Ta = [(d/s)+11:50]....... Equation 1
Where:
- Ta = Arrival time
- d = distance from Leicester to London
- s = Speed
From the question,
Given:
Substitute these values into equation 1
- Ta = [(100/80)+11:50]
- Ta = 1.25h+11:50
- Ta = 1 hours 15 minutes +11:50
- Ta = 13:05 pm
Hence, the arrival time in london of a train that leaves Leicester to london at 11:50 A.M is 13:05 pm.
